Oak Dunin

Oak tree (Quercus robur. L.) is one of the largest trees in Białowieża Primeval Forest, one of the most known lowland forests, not only in Poland but also in Europe. Its age is estimated at 400 years, it measures over 13 metres and is approximately 4.5 metres in circumference.

The tree grows on the edge of the forest on the periphery of the village of Przybudki. In the past, it was struck by lightning. There used to be guard boxes separating the royal forests. 

Today it stands alone, the old original forest that surrounded it has been cut down, but the oak still stands proudly in the wide expanse of the Bialowieza Forest.

Białowieża Forest

The forest is located near the eastern border of Poland and Belarus and is one of the most valuable natural ecosystems in Europe. It is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and parts of it are also included in the Natura 2000 network.

European Region of Wisent

The symbol of this region is undoubtedly the European bison. In the early 20th century the animal was extirpated here, but the bison population has returned over time and today the area is known as the 'European Region of Wisent'.

Name "Dunin"

The tree is named Dunin in honour of the Belarusian poet and playwright Vincent Dunin Marcinkiewicz, previously known as the Guardian of the Forest. In Poland, he became an inspiration for many artists, featuring on the cover of a music album, in several films and paintings.

The tree's present disheveled shape is the result of a lightning strike that broke the tree's branches. Due to the poor state of the tree's health, the municipality organised a collection for the tree's treatment, in which it managed to raise about 10,000 zlotys to save it.

Oak Dunin was announced as a European Tree of the Year 2022 winner during the Award Ceremony in Brussels. The prize was handed over to Agnieszka Przygodzka on behalf of Klub Gaja, Polish environmental organization that nominated the oak into the contest.

The tree was supported by 179 317 voters and so reached the record number of votes in the history of the contest.

Oak Dunin was not the only succesful oak tree in the contest in 2022. Oak of Conxo's Banquet Forest from Spain was placed 2nd and the 3rd place went to Portugal to The Big Cork Oak.
